Alabama rapper OMB Peezy is really free. Footage is circulating online showing buzz about his release from jail on bond is no cap. The Instagram clip shows Peezy being embraced by family and friends days after getting put behind bars for a possible connection to a February 2021 shooting.
While he’s yet to speak on the details of his arrest, OMB went to his Instagram to earlier in the week to proclaim his innocence. Peezy let followers know he isn’t responsible for the crimes police believe he may have committed.
The drama stems from a February attack at a music video shoot for rap artists 42 Dugg and Roddy Ricch.
